The Kewpie Primer is a children's book written by Rose O'Neill and published in 1916. The book features the beloved Kewpie characters, which O'Neill had created in her illustrations for Ladies' Home Journal. The Kewpie Primer is designed to teach young children the basics of reading and writing through the use of colorful illustrations and simple sentences. The book includes lessons on letter recognition, phonics, and basic vocabulary. The Kewpie characters are used to engage children and make the learning process fun and enjoyable. The book is considered a classic in children's literature and has been reprinted numerous times.
